Nuella Njubigbo Welcomes Baby Boy, Giovanni Munachimso, with New Husband

Nollywood actress Nuella Njubigbo is in high spirits as she announces the arrival of her second child, a baby boy named Giovanni Munachimso, with her undisclosed partner. Sharing the joyous news on Instagram along with her maternity photos, she expressed gratitude and awe for the blessing.

In one of her posts, Nuella thanked the Lord, stating, “Santa came early for my family and I. Giovanni Munachimso is here. Ekene Dili gi Chukwuma.” She also shared her overflowing joy, saying, “Here we go!! Thank you, Lord. Heart filled with praise! My imagination has become reality. Oh my god o! You do this one oo. El Roi. What God cannot do doesn’t exist.”

Her colleagues and friends in the entertainment industry, including Yul Edochie, Rita Dominic, Uche Elendu, Destiny Etiko, Junior Pope, and many others, extended their warm congratulations and best wishes for Nuella and her newborn.

This celebration comes after the actress made headlines for her second marriage to Jean, the ex-husband of Uche Ogbodo, another Nollywood actress. Nuella’s previous marriage to producer Tchidi Chikere ended in divorce in 2021. Tchidi, now married to his third wife, clarified that Nuella initiated the separation by leaving the house without his knowledge.
